What you can do
Customer service, hold times and resiliency all benefit when your supply chain is closer to your customers. Onshoring or nearshoring also improves supply chain risk management.
54%
of US executives think manufacturing closer to home is key to survival
Use predictive technology to foresee disruptions before they happen. Use continuity-focused technology to get real-time insights and data-sharing across suppliers and factories.
48%
of high tech companies are focused on creating new AI-powered products or services.
Understand your customer needs and your data earlier in the supply chain design process. Making earlier development decisions helps improve the network’s resilience, cycle times and product quality while reducing costs.
Enable your people, increase productivity and decrease redundancies by using automated tools and data-driven analytics.
